Sustainable Holdings Selected for Revitalization Project in Former Koishihara Elementary School Area

Sustainable Holdings Takes the Lead in Local Revitalization



In a significant step toward revitalizing the community, Sustainable Holdings Co., Ltd., headquartered in Shibuya, Tokyo, has been selected as the operator for the redevelopment of the former Koishihara Elementary School site in Higashitake Village, Fukuoka Prefecture. This initiative is part of the village's broader efforts to invigorate the local area and make effective use of public facilities.

The selection was officially announced by Higashitake Village as part of a strategic plan designed to enhance regional livability and foster sustainable development. Sustainable Holdings, known for its commitment to renewable energy and community enhancement projects, will hold priority negotiation rights for the lease agreement concerning the site. This unique position allows the company to develop a comprehensive plan for the revitalization of the area, ensuring that it meets the needs and aspirations of the local residents.
